### 1.12.0 — Rotation for extraction tooling

The Phraseforge translation-string extraction script now signs its output catalogs so the Lindenmere build servers can verify them before merging into locale bundles. As part of this release we rotated the catalog signing credentials; anything signed with the previous key will be rejected starting next cycle. If you're setting up a local environment as a new contractor, run the extractor once with `--verify` to confirm your toolchain matches. The active signing key for this release is listed below.

deploy key for kajof-fajop: bky6_gDHw9Q

## PointsLedger Release Step 4

Before promoting the Stampwise loyalty-points ledger, freeze accrual writes and confirm the reconciliation job has drained. Replays are idempotent, so a second pass is safe if counts drift. Do not bump the schema version mid-release; Harwick signs off on that separately. Once the drain completes, apply the settings below to the canary node.

settings of fafog-haduf:
ZORIX_PIN=4648
ZORIX_METRICS_HOST=metrics.zorix.paliqsys.corp
ZORIX_LOG_LEVEL=info
ZORIX_TENANT=druix

**Action item (from the Fernvale release postmortem):** Snapshot tests for the Lattice UI kit flaked for weeks because diff tolerance and render timeouts were scattered across suites. Consolidate them into one constants module; CI must import from there only. Future maintainers: do not bump tolerances inline to silence a failing snapshot — update the shared module and note why. Owner: Dara. Due next sprint. The consolidated constants are as follows.

limits module of hahap-yafog:
THRESHOLDS = {
    "weneth": 555,
    "jorix": 223,
    "eliius": 753,
}

Ticket LT-903: Run load tests against the Cartfall checkout flow before the Harvestview release. Target is 400 concurrent sessions sustained for 30 minutes with payment stubs enabled. Record p95 latency and error rates in the results page. Future maintainers should rerun this suite after any gateway change. Sign-off required from the engineer named below.

account owner for bawip-tahag: Raleth Quenok